Items Acceptable for Recycling

Items Not Acceptable for Recycling

1. Clear Glass Jars: vegetable, soup, juice etc.

Ceramic/clay pots, chinaware, porcelain, light bulbs, windows, mirrors, plate glass.

2. Paper: Newspaper, newsprint, inserts, computer paper, white bond, magazines,telephone books, envelopes(no window)

Junk mail, paper towels, paper tissue, toilet paper, loose leaf paper, carbon leaf paper, envelopes, plastic laminated paper, writing paper, gift wrap paper, brown paper bags.

3. Cardboard: Corrugated cardboard (broken down, flattened and tied), egg cartons (cardboard or styrofoam)

Plastic coated packaging, frozen juice containers, food boxes, detergent boxes.

4. Plastic: Plastic film, (grocery bags), plastic containers - Type I (milk bottles, windshield washer fluid bottles, vinegar bottles, juice bottles), Type II (margarine tubs, ice cream pails, sour cream tubs)

 

Biodegradable/Photodegradable bags, foam plastic,  milk bags, plastic food wrap, herbicide, fertilizer, pesticide containers, diapers, toothpaste containers, dishes and cutlery, gasoline containers,  bleach bottles, fabric softener bottles, detergent bottles.

5. Cans: Tin food cans, aluminum cans.

  

6. Bottles: Beer, wine, liquor, plastic and glass soft drink bottles

  

7. Tetra Packs: all tetra packs(all sizes), gable-ended juice containers, lids removed

   

8.  Engine Oil Containers: empty engine oil containers (leave lids on)

   

9.  Boxboard-single layered cardboard (cereal boxes, pop cases, cracker & shoe boxes). Please make sure that all plastic and waxed paper are removed from boxboard before recycling.
